Output db22f407339eaa4a8f33c36f300f86fc62f81a3e1a7e689d580b83740ae7d42a:1

value
12857878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5008f16dbfb15ed72ffc783ff88d19cf2222f3a OP_EQUAL
address
3JC4u6pFVuFx28nfDaZveX2VLihV99mjAS
transaction
db22f407339eaa4a8f33c36f300f86fc62f81a3e1a7e689d580b83740ae7d42a
spent
true